Transaction 833053d2fab8884c067ba198167749c21204017f441bde193fe643d0df9f2802
1 Input
1 Output
-
833053d2fab8884c067ba198167749c21204017f441bde193fe643d0df9f2802:0
- value
- 902738
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c1bf4ba4f17761fa04466bcaf5ffa2166b7ca8b OP_EQUALVERIFY OP_CHECKSIG
- address
- 17wRqzeBRbWr5QDyf3diDCpr4bsYnYGpxq